Starting with Silves: The Historic Charm
The tour begins with hotel pickup in Albufeira, a straightforward way to start if you’re staying locally. From there, it’s about a 30-minute drive inland to Silves, a town that played a pivotal role during the Moorish times in Portugal. The highlight here is Silves Castle, a well-preserved fortress that offers sweeping views over the town and surrounding countryside. As one review notes, “Visiting the castle was great! Loved seeing and learning about all the fruit trees along the way.” The castle’s ramparts and towers are perfect for photos, and your guide will share stories about its history and strategic importance.
Next, you’ll visit Silves Cathedral, nestled within the town’s charming streets. It’s a beautiful example of religious architecture, with interior pieces that narrate the building’s evolution through centuries. One traveler mentioned, “Silves Cathedral is a unique place full of historical pieces that tell the story of the region.” Walking through the narrow streets of Silves, you can soak in the authentic atmosphere and perhaps grab a quick coffee or pastry.
The Mountain Peak: Fóia and Monchique
After exploring Silves, the tour continues toward Monchique, a quaint mountain town. Passing through its center, you’ll get glimpses of daily life in this peaceful spot. The real highlight is Fóia, the highest point in the Algarve at 902 meters. The drive up offers some lovely scenic views, and once at the top, you’ll be rewarded with panoramic vistas stretching across the Algarve and beyond. It’s a moment to breathe in fresh mountain air and appreciate the region’s diverse landscape.

Practical Details and Value
The cost of $45 per person for this 4-hour experience is quite reasonable considering the transportation, guide, and the key sights visited. The minivan is air-conditioned, ensuring comfort in the Algarve’s warm climate. Pickup and drop-off from your hotel make it convenient, and the tour is flexible enough to fit into a busy travel schedule.
One thing to keep in mind: entry fees are not included in the price. The castle’s €2.80 fee is paid directly at the site, which some travelers might overlook if they rely solely on the description. The guides are upfront about this, but it’s good to budget ahead.
